Yes, they are for your subs crew. Interesting file btw. Much in there to play around.
My goal is to make them spot vessles when they are visible to the player.
I have a career savegame where i´m closing to a convoy early in the morning.
With the stock file the crew spots at 17500 meters but you see the vessel at around 10000 meters. (morning, sunset).
Edit:
Just did a test with the scapa flow single mission with good results.
Patrol started at dawn, i set course hammerd in time compression and waited for results:
1. DD spotted by my crew 1 hour later, range 6000, little daylight left he didn´t saw me.
2. DD spotted by my crew after another hour, range 4500 meter, almost no daylight left, he didnt saw me.
3. DD 1 hour later, night has fallen,recognized him when he opened fire at my sub :P , not spotted by my crew at all.

Sounds good to me, will do more testing.
It seems that you have good control over your crews ability to spot something at night/dusk/dawn with the "Visual light factor" value.
I guess something around 8 here is a good value.

Edit:
8 is to high, perhaps 6-7 will be ok.
